Apache Cassandra

by Radical Technologies Claim Listing

Apache Cassandra is an open-source, distributed NoSQL database management system designed for high availability, scalability, and fault tolerance. It was originally developed by Facebook and later open-sourced as part of the Apache Software Foundation.

Price : Enquire Now

Contact the Institutes

Fill this form

Advertisement

Radical Technologies Logo

img Duration

Please Enquire

Course Details

Apache Cassandra is an open-source, distributed NoSQL database management system designed for high availability, scalability, and fault tolerance. It was originally developed by Facebook and later open-sourced as part of the Apache Software Foundation.

 

Syllabus:

  • Module 1: Introduction to Apache Cassandra
  • Overview of NoSQL databases and Cassandra.
  • History and evolution of Cassandra.
  • Cassandra’s features and use cases.
  • Distributed database concepts.
  • Module 2: Cassandra Data Model
  • Understanding the Cassandra data model (tables, rows, columns).
  • Primary keys and clustering columns.
  • Data types in Cassandra.
  • Composite keys and collections (sets, lists, maps).
  • Module 3: Data Modeling in Cassandra
  • Best practices for data modeling.
  • Denormalization and designing for queries.
  • Understanding the CAP theorem in the context of Cassandra.
  • Creating and managing tables in Cassandra.
  • Module 4: Querying Data in Cassandra
  • CQL (Cassandra Query Language) basics.
  • SELECT statements and filtering data.
  • UPDATE, DELETE, and INSERT operations.
  • Batch operations and lightweight transactions.
  • Module 5: Data Distribution and Replication
  • Cassandra’s distributed architecture.
  • Partitioning and data distribution.
  • Replica placement and consistency levels.
  • Handling data distribution and replication for high availability.
  • Module 6: Tuning and Optimization
  • Monitoring and metrics in Cassandra.
  • Tuning Cassandra for performance.
  • Compaction and compression strategies.
  • Handling large-scale data.
  • Module 7: Security in Cassandra
  • Authentication and authorization.
  • Encryption and SSL/TLS.
  • Data encryption at rest.
  • Securing Cassandra clusters.
  • Module 8: Backup and Recovery
  • Backup strategies and options.
  • Point-in-time recovery.
  • Backup and restore procedures.
  • Data durability and fault tolerance.
  • Module 9: Apache Cassandra Operations
  • Deploying Cassandra clusters.
  • Managing nodes and adding/removing nodes.
  • Maintenance and upgrades.
  • Troubleshooting common issues.
  • Module 10: Integrations and Ecosystem
  • Using drivers and client libraries (Java, Python, etc.).
  • Integrating Cassandra with other technologies (Spark, Elasticsearch, etc.).
  • Exploring the Cassandra ecosystem and tools.
  • Module 11: Use Cases and Real-World Examples
  • Case studies and examples of Cassandra in production.
  • Architectural patterns and best practices for specific use cases.
  • Building scalable and fault-tolerant applications.
  • Module 12: Advanced Topics (Optional)
  • Time-series data modeling.
  • Multi-datacenter and cross-region replication.
  • Consistency and tunable consistency.
  • Advanced troubleshooting and performance optimization.
  • Kochi Branch

    Office No 44/71,44/72 , KP Varkey Complex MKK Nair Road, PO, Kochi
  • Pune Branch

    4th Floor, Medhi Park, DP Rd, above Bata Showroom, opposite Shiv Sagar Hotel, Harmony Society, Ward No. 8, Wireless Colony, Aundh, Pune
  • Thrissur Branch

    Suharsha Towers, 2nd, Complex, Thrissur

Check out more Apache Cassandra courses in India

SICS (Shah Institute Of Computer Science) Logo

MySQL

MySQL course is offered by SICS ((Shah Institute Of Computer Science). SICS offers courses in diverse domains to college students, graduates and experienced working professionals. These courses enable individuals to get an unrivalled boost in their career graph.

by SICS (Shah Institute Of Computer Science) [Claim Listing ]
Trinity Technologies Logo

Microsoft SQL Server

Microsoft SQL Server is a relational database management system developed by Microsoft. As a database server, it is a software product with the primary function of storing and retrieving data as requested by other software applications.

by Trinity Technologies [Claim Listing ]
Getin Technologies Logo

Apache Cassandra Training

Empower yourself with comprehensive Apache Cassandra training at Getin technologies, wherein industry specialists will guide you thru mastering the intricacies of this powerful allotted database machine.

by Getin Technologies [Claim Listing ]
The British Institutes Logo

Oracle Training

Oracle course is offered by The British Institutes for all skill level. The British Institutes is one of India's leading educators, with focus on diverse segments of education, and across learners of multiple age-groups. 

by The British Institutes [Claim Listing ]
APT Education Society Logo

Certificate In DBMS (Bata Base Management)

Certificate in DBMS (Bata Base Management) course is offered by APT Education Society. APT Education has been introducing training programmes to meet the challenges of computer revolution. APT Education has developed a set of certificate courses each for long duration and short duration.

by APT Education Society [Claim Listing ]

© 2024 coursetakers.com All Rights Reserved. Terms and Conditions of use | Privacy Policy